About us
Bourne Leisure is one of the largest providers of holidays and holiday home ownership in the UK. Our brands Haven, Butlins and Warner Leisure Hotels are amongst the most recognised within the UK holiday market.  Bourne Leisure has more than 6,000 team members that work across their three brands, which rises to nearly 14,000 during peak periods.
 
Haven is now the largest privately-owned holiday operator in the UK, with 38 Parks around the British Coastline.  Our 23,500 holiday home owners and our 2.5 million holiday guests come to Haven each year to enjoy ‘a breath of fresh air’ experience at the seaside away from daily life and look forward to spending quality family time together.
